Double Crust Bean Pie
=====================
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
1 onion, finely chopped
1 small green bell pepper, chopped
1 (15 ounce) can black beans, drained
1/3 cup salsa
1/4 cup chopped red bell pepper
3/4 teaspoon chili powder
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
2 (9 inch) unbaked 9 inch pie crusts
1 1/2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ese
Preheat oven to 325F. Heat oil in a medium saucepan over medium
heat. Saute onion and green pepper until tender. Sir in beans, salsa,
red bell pepper, chili powder, cayenne and black pepper. Reduce heat
to low and simmer for 15 minutes.
Spoon half of the mixture into one of the pie crusts and cover with
half of the cheese. Repeat with remaining beans and cheese. Top with
remaining crust. Bake in preheated oven for 1 hour.
